    The Story of Izabel

    Izabel stems from the Hebrew 'Elisheva,' meaning 'God is my oath,' evolving through Spanish 'Isabel' in medieval Europe. Its history traces to biblical figures, gaining prominence among royalty like Queen Isabella of Castile in the 15th century, who influenced global naming. The 'z' variant emerged in the 20th century as an anglicized, stylized form, popular in English and Portuguese-speaking regions. This evolution reflects adaptations for phonetic appeal and individuality in diverse cultures.
